Hourly UV Index in Barrio Nuevo del Progreso

The UV Index for the day reveals a clear pattern of increasing intensity as the sun climbs higher in the sky. Starting from a safe 0 at 07:00, the index gently rises to 1 at 08:00 and then to 2 by 09:00. However, as midday approaches, the readings spike dramatically, peaking at an intense 14 at 14:00. This midday heat marks the highest risk for sun exposure, with a staggering 11 seen at 12:00 and 13 at 13:00. The afternoon brings a gradual decline, with the UV Index dropping to 9 at 16:00 and continuing to decrease to 2 by 18:00. As the day transitions into evening, the risk subsides, settling at 1 by 19:00. This data underscores the importance of sun safety during peak hours, particularly between 11:00 and 15:00.

UV Risk Categories

  •  Extreme (11+): Avoid the sun, stay in shade.
  •  Very High (8-10): Limit sun exposure.
  •  High (6-7): Use SPF 30+ and protective clothing.
  •  Moderate (3-5): Midday shade recommended.
  •  Low (0-2): No protection needed.
